PINK1 Gene PARK6 Parkinson NGS Genetic DNA Test
Introduction
The PINK1 Gene PARK6 Parkinson NGS Genetic DNA Test is an advanced diagnostic tool that plays a crucial role in understanding genetic predispositions to Parkinson’s disease. This test utilizes state-of-the-art Next-Generation Sequencing (NGS) technology to analyze the PINK1 gene, which is known to be involved in mitochondrial function and neuronal survival. Early detection of genetic mutations can significantly impact treatment options and disease management.
What the Test Measures
This test specifically measures mutations in the PINK1 gene, which are associated with familial forms of Parkinson’s disease. By identifying these mutations, the test helps in assessing the risk of developing Parkinson’s and guides clinical decisions.
Who Should Consider This Test
Individuals with a family history of Parkinson’s disease or those experiencing early symptoms such as tremors, stiffness, or balance issues should consider this test. Additionally, individuals with risk factors such as age and genetic predisposition may benefit from understanding their genetic status.

Understanding Your Results
Results from the PINK1 Gene PARK6 Parkinson NGS Genetic DNA Test will indicate whether any mutations are present. A genetic counselor will help interpret the results, explaining their implications for personal health and family risk. It is vital to discuss these results with a healthcare provider for comprehensive understanding and planning.

Turnaround Time: 3 to 4 Weeks
Sample Type: Blood or Extracted DNA or One drop Blood on FTA Card
Pre-Test Instructions: Clinical history of the patient going for the test and a genetic counseling session to draw a pedigree chart of family members affected with PINK1 Gene PARK6 Parkinson.
Specialty: Neurology
Department: Genetics
Method: NGS Technology
Disease Type: Neurological Disorders
